Transaction 42154db2089366c700f57c868937456155a0c118f97352240bb50694bde55615

1 Input
2 Outputs
  • 42154db2089366c700f57c868937456155a0c118f97352240bb50694bde55615:0
  • value  108698
    address  3BnofnKy8ek8ZgXtwXWcrSXqh88NcUPAmq
  • 42154db2089366c700f57c868937456155a0c118f97352240bb50694bde55615:1
  • value  1149022
    address  3PBuM3DufmnNknouWeVfL4U2UxVeZCqCsL